Warren Young has presented to The Roar a new Rugby League concept which was pitched to the NRL in a two hour meeting. Warren’s concept is available for you to consider and we welcome your comments.

More Games For TV / Less Burden On Rep Players / Every Player Available For Every Premiership Game
By Warren Young

This year I created a proposal and supplement for the NRL to try to attain a better TV rights deal by restructuring the competition.

The idea behind this concept is to create a competition that doesn’t disadvantage teams during the State of Origin, reduces the wear and tear on representative players, and excites fans.

I have created a round robin competition during Origin to be held over a 5 week period.

It is also designed to create maximum TV revenue with fresh ideas, a new competition, options for more advertising revenue, and still maintaining tradition in the greatest game of all.

Teams are split into 4 Conferences, each with 5 teams: Sydney East, Sydney West, Provincial North, Provincial South.

Central Coast Bears and a second Brisbane team are included, leaving two spaces. I propose the 19th and 20th teams will be made up by Qld and NSW U20’s.

Two Semis and a Final are to be played in the fifth week. Origin is to be held over 3 consecutive weeks, followed by a ANZAC Test.

This will create full rounds of rugby league during the origin season.

Calender:

Round 1 to 10
Origin and Origin Cup Series (Round Robin)
Round 11 to 20
Finals

I have also created a Second-Tier comp to be made up from the remaining contracted players and the rest of the numbers to be made up by U20’s (G220).

Each round has also been carefully examined with the inclusion of two rivalry rounds, a special wild card round, and considers the salary cap, All Stars games, Internationals, and the World Club Challenge in a comprehensive study.

I have received positive feedback from some clubs and I’d be interested to hear fans thoughts.
